Vouchers for service, hearing, … WebJul 15, 2016 · Some autism service dogs are trained to recognize and gently interrupt self-harming behaviors or help de-escalate an emotional meltdown. For instance, it might respond to signs of anxiety or agitation with a calming action such as leaning against the child (or adult) or gently laying across his or her lap.

Autism Applicant Criteria: Young adults must be at 18 + and be able to take full responsibility physically, emotionally, and financially for the dog. Must have an Autism diagnosis. Applicant must be in a therapeutic program for a minimum of six months.

WebMar 6, 2024 · A service dog is going to cost more than an emotional support dog but is sometimes the best choice. Since emotional support animals have no legal rights, unlike service animals, your child can be told that he must leave his dog and not allow it on a plane, in a restaurant, or many other places. ...
